    Well in terms of power consumption; if you were to run a gpu folding client on your particular graphics card, you'd be using an extra 144W of power compared to when the card is sitting idle at the Windows desktop.

    The extra power usage for a cpu client would be less than that, if you haven't got any energy saving features enabled for your cpu then you'd see even less difference between folding/not folding on the processor.
